Etymology: Chauliodus: Greek, chaulios, chaulos, chaunos = to be with the mouth opened + Greek, odous = teeth (Ref. 45335);  macouni: Named after Prof. J.C. Macoun, Geological Survey of Canada, a resolute pioneer of western Canada (Ref. 6885).

Environment: milieu / climate zone / depth range / distribution range Écologie

marin bathypélagique; profondeur 25 - 4390 m (Ref. 5610). Deep-water; 66°N - 23°N, 127°E - 106°W

Distribution Pays | Zones FAO | Écosystèmes | Occurrences | Point map | Introductions | Faunafri

Northwest Pacific: Navarin Canyon in the Bering Sea to Japan. Eastern Pacific: Gulf of Alaska to central Baja California (Ref. 35898) and the Gulf of California.

Taille / Poids / Âge

Maturity: Lm ?  range ? - ? cm
Max length : 29.3 cm TL mâle / non sexé; (Ref. 80637); poids max. publié: 23.35 g (Ref. 4525); âge max. reporté: 8 années (Ref. 28499)

Description synthétique Morphologie | Morphométrie

Épines dorsales (Total): 0; Rayons mous dorsaux (Total): 5-7; Épines anales 0; Rayons mous anaux: 9 - 14; Vertèbres: 56 - 62. First dorsal fin ray much produced in a long filament terminating in a minute flap; adipose fin large, placed well back over posterior part of anal, higher posteriorly; pelvic fins long and narrow (Ref. 6885). No true gill rakers (Ref. 6885). Dark brown to black in color (Ref. 6885). Branchiostegal rays: 16-21 (Ref. 35898).

Biologie     Glossaire (ex. epibenthic)

Migrate upward at night (Ref. 28499). Feed on small planktonic crustaceans, arrow worms and fish (Ref. 28499). Has photophores on belly arranged in a row (Ref. 2850). Oviparous, with planktonic eggs and larvae (Ref. 35898). Also caught with bottom trawls.
